Historical Vacation Spots
When choosing a place in which to take a vacation, you may want to consider what sort of activities you would like to do when you reach your destination. While spending a holiday on the beach relaxing might be a great break, exploring a country's rich culture and history can be immensely rewarding. All of the world's countries have been built on years of struggle and effort, and learning about the process can be just as enjoyable as enjoying the result. Below are some of the most historical and fascinating destinations in the world.

Washington DC
This is the city that cradles the political and historical core of the USA. Home to the White House, Capitol Hill, The National Mall and many other areas of interest, it is a great place to wander around while soaking in the past. Boston
The city of Boston is home to many important events in American history. It is the final resting place of such American Heroes as Samuel Adams, John Hancock and Paul Revere, and was where the famous Boston Tea Party took place. Rome
Rome is probably one of the most historically relevant and fascinating cities in the world. Known as the cradle of modern civilization, the city of Rome represents the intellect, advancement and establishment of the modern world. It is a wonderful vacation spot for all types, including art lovers, cuisine and wine connoisseurs, history buffs and those who are just looking for some excitement. Paris
Paris is a city that has become synonymous with sophistication and style. This beautiful place is also packed with European history and is one of the most important places in the art world. AS you wander the city you will see many monuments commemorating representing important parts of French history, and will be treated to a lifestyle that loves to indulge in the finer things in life: art, food, wine, good company, romance and relaxation. Nepal
Nepal is a place you don't find in standard vacation brochures it is a place for travellers that are looking for a more adventurous experience. Nepal is a place of great beauty and a variety of landscapes ranging from rolling hills to the peak of Mt. Everest, the highest mountain in the Himalayas. Once known as Kathmandu (which is still the capital city today), Nepal has a long and rich history. Due to its geographical location, between China and India, Nepal has a number of influences on its culture including Buddhism, Hinduism, Caucasoid and Mongoloid religions and cultures.

There are a number of ways to experience the culture and adventures that Nepal has to offer. Trekking through Nepal's countryside and mountains will expose you to breathtaking scenery, flora and fauna and rural villages. One of the best adventures you can take is a Jungle Safari. There are excellent wildlife reserves throughout the country where you will see many animals such as tigers, snow leopards, the rare red panda and many other animals seldom seen in the wild.
